引言:本文以案例研究方式,剖析TP钱包在薄饼(PancakeSwap)生态中从用户接入到交易落地的完整技术链路,聚焦高科技突破、浏览器钱包交互、私密身份认证、多链支付整合、实时数据监控、行情查看与智能合约实现。

案例概述:交易团队“星桥”需在BSC与侧链间执行低滑点跨链套利,同时保护交易者身份并实时监控风险。目标是用TP钱包作为前端入口,整合聚合路由、桥接服务与风控模块,保证体验与安全。
技术要点与流程分析:
1) 浏览器钱包与身份认证:TP钱包通过浏览器扩展与Web3注入实现页面连接,采用EIP-712标准进行离线签名。为满足隐私要求,集成去中心化身份DID与零知识证明(如zk-SNARK/zk-STARK),在不暴露真实身份或资产明细的前提下完成授权声明。多方签名/MPC可用于托管级别私钥分片,降低单点风险。
2) 多链支付整合:交易发起端通过链上路由器查询聚合器报价(包括PancakeSwap、其它AMM与DEX),若需跨链,调用桥接合约或聚合桥(使用锁定-铸造或燃烧-再铸模型)。支付流程通常为:批准代币→路由器swap→桥接合约提交跨链证明→目标链完成清算。为优化用户体验,采用账户抽象(ERC-4337)与paymaster机制https://www.sxrgtc.com ,完成手续费赞助与代付。
3) 智能合约技术:在薄饼生态,使用AMM路由、滑点保护、限价逻辑与闪兑(flash swap)策略;合约设计采用可升级代理、重入保护、权限最小化与事件化日志。EIP-2612 permit模式可减少approve次数,降低用户交互成本。
4) 实时数据监控与行情查看:行情与链上状态通过链上预言机(Chainlink)、事件索引(The Graph)与WebSocket节点结合,实时推送价格、深度、txpool与确认状态。风控模块基于规则与机器学习模型识别夹层攻击、前置交易和滑点异常,触发自动撤单或分步执行策略。
具体执行流程(简化):用户在TP钱包选定交易→钱包生成并本地签名交易摘要→前端查询聚合路由并模拟滑点→如果跨链,预估桥费并提示→用户确认(使用zk证明隐藏身份字段可选)→提交至薄饼路由器合约→桥接/清算→监控模块实时校验事件并上报异常。

结语:该案例显示,将浏览器钱包与隐私认证、多链支付与实时监控结合,可在保证用户体验的同时提升安全与合规性。未来方向包括更广泛的zk技术落地、低成本的跨链原生结算与更智能的MEV防护,以实现TP钱包在DeFi生态中的高效、隐私和可扩展运行。